Understanding DTF White Ink

DTF (Direct to Film) printing is a method that allows for high-quality prints on a variety of materials. The use of white ink in DTF printing has become increasingly important, particularly for those working with dark or colored substrates.

Expert Opinions on DTF White Ink

Enhanced Color Vibrancy

According to Emily Torres, a printing technology consultant, “DTF White Ink acts as a primer, providing a solid base for colors. This enhances vibrancy and ensures that prints stand out, especially on darker fabrics.” Her insights highlight a critical advantage for professionals aiming to deliver eye-catching prints.

Improved Coverage and Opacity

Mark Rivera, an experienced graphic designer, adds, “With DTF White Ink, we can achieve better coverage and opacity. This leads to prints that maintain their integrity over time, ensuring that details are sharp and colors are true to the original design.” This benefit is vital for professionals who require longevity in their printed materials.

Cost Efficiency in Operations

Another perspective comes from Linda Chow, a production manager at a printing firm. She states, “Using DTF White Ink can reduce the need for multiple print passes, which not only saves time but also lowers ink consumption. In a competitive industry, this cost efficiency can significantly boost profitability.”

Versatility of Applications

Further, George Patel, an expert in textile printing, emphasizes versatility: “DTF White Ink extends the range of materials we can print on. From cotton to polyester blends, the ability to use white ink makes it possible to cater to varied client needs.” This flexibility is a key factor for professionals in meeting diverse customer requests.
